社群运营在编程圈中扮演着至关重要的角色。它不仅能够帮助程序员们相互交流、学习,还能够促进技术的传播和创新。以下是一些详细的指导,帮助编程圈玩转社群运营之道。
一、明确社群定位和目标
1. 目标人群定位
- 明确受众:首先,要明确社群的目标受众,例如初学者、中级开发者、高级工程师或者特定技术领域的专家。
- 需求分析:了解目标人群的需求,包括他们希望解决的问题、学习的技能、关注的技术趋势等。
2. 社群目标设定
- 学习交流:提供技术学习、经验分享的平台。
- 问题解决:建立问题解答区,帮助成员解决编程难题。
- 资源整合:分享开发资源、工具和最佳实践。
二、构建良好的社群内容
1. 内容类型
- 技术文章:定期发布高质量的技术文章,涵盖编程语言、框架、工具等。
- 教程视频:提供编程教程视频,帮助成员快速学习。
- 案例研究:分享成功的项目案例,提供实际操作经验。
2. 内容发布策略
- 定期更新:保持内容更新的频率,维持社群活跃度。
- 互动性:鼓励成员参与讨论,提高内容的互动性。
三、增强社群互动
1. 互动活动
- 线上研讨会:定期举办线上研讨会,邀请行业专家分享经验。
- 编程马拉松:组织编程马拉松活动,鼓励成员共同解决实际问题。
2. 互动工具
- 在线聊天工具:使用Slack、Telegram等工具,方便成员之间的即时沟通。
- 论坛系统:建立论坛,让成员可以自由讨论和提问。
四、社群管理
1. 管理团队
- 核心成员:选拔有热情、有能力的成员担任核心管理角色。
- 分工明确:明确管理团队的职责,确保社群运营的有序进行。
2. 规则制定
- 行为准则:制定社群行为准则,规范成员行为。
- 奖惩机制:建立奖惩机制,鼓励积极行为,惩罚违规行为。
五、自动化运营
1. 自动回复
- 常见问题:预设常见问题的自动回复,提高效率。
- 欢迎新成员:自动发送欢迎信息,让新成员感受到社群的温暖。
2. 定时发布
- 内容发布:使用自动化工具定时发布内容,保持社群活跃度。
六、案例分析
1. 成功案例
- GitHub:作为一个开源社区,GitHub通过提供代码托管和协作平台,吸引了全球的开发者。
- Stack Overflow:作为一个问答社区,Stack Overflow通过高质量的问题和答案,帮助开发者解决问题。
2. 失败案例
- 过于商业化:一些社群因为过于商业化而失去了原本的活力。
- 缺乏管理:一些社群因为缺乏有效的管理而变得混乱。
七、总结
社群运营是编程圈中不可或缺的一环。通过明确社群定位、构建优质内容、增强互动、有效管理以及利用自动化工具,编程圈可以玩转社群运营之道,为成员提供有价值的服务,同时促进技术的传播和创新。